Domaine Zafeirakis Rosé of Limniona, PGI Tyrnavos, Greece 2024
From one of Greece’s most forward-thinking estates, Christos Zafeirakis (4th-generation family winemaker) applies over a century of family know-how—and biodynamic rigor—to this pure expression of Limniona in rosé form.
-
WINEMAKER: Christos Zafeirakis,
-
FARMING: Organic and biodynamic (in conversion or practice as of recent years); sustainable estate management.
-
VARIETY: 100 % Limniona
-
TERROIR: PGI Tyrnavos, Thessaly—central Greece. The estate sources from their Tyrnavos holdings, steeped in local tradition.
-
VINIFICATION: Classic free-run rosé method; fermented with indigenous yeasts; no malolactic fermentation. Grapes chilled (~24 hours at 4 °C) pre-press to preserve freshness.
-
AGING: Stainless steel with no oak influence; bottled early to retain energy and clarity.
-
TASTING NOTES: Wild-strawberry, cranberry, cherry, herbal nuances, and subtle floral or Mediterranean herb notes.
-
FOOD PAIRINGS: A natural with savory salads, seafood, light Greek dishes like shellfish or grilled fare—plus unexpectedly versatile with chicken or turkey.
